![](https://img-blog.csdnimg.cn/20201014180756738.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Atomic原子类
dong_dong2211
低调,取舍间,有得有失!
展开
-
原子操作数组类AtomicIntegerArray
基本数据定义数组 :int [] intArray= new int[100]; 原子类型定义数组: AtomicInteger [] aiArray= new AtomicIntegre[100]; 两者所定义的形式并未不同,知识类型不同而已。 JDK中提供了操作原子数组的类:AtomicIntegerArray 该类的定义如下: AtomicIn...原创 2019-10-31 12:52:14 · 707 阅读 · 0 评论 -
AtomicStampedReference类
AtomicStampedReference 类维护了一个对象的引用reference 和一个整型值stamp,这两个值可以原子性地进行更新。 AtomicStampedRederence 类的定义: public class AtomicStampedReference<V> extends Object 构造方法如下: AtomicStam...原创 2019-10-31 11:11:06 · 346 阅读 · 0 评论 -
扩展的原子引用类型:AtomicMarkableReference
AtomicMarkableReference类是一个线程安全的类,该类封装了一个对象的引用reference和一个布尔值mark,可以原子性地对这两个值进行更新。 定义: public class AtomicMarkableReference<V> exntends Object 其中,V为需要标记的原子操作的类型。 该类的构造方法如下:...原创 2019-10-30 14:19:11 · 2653 阅读 · 1 评论